Iowa farmer hopeful Summit carbon pipeline project continues

An Iowa farmer says the recent passage of a bill to restrict eminent domain by the state legislature creates uncertainty about the future of carbon pipelines. Kelly Nieuwenhuis says he was an early supporter of the Summit Carbon Solutions pipeline. “I was very disappointed that the Iowa Senate would pass a bill like this this […]
